“I could go vegan…but I’d miss cheese!”

I have heard that phrase so much, and I have also been guilty of saying it! Cheese is one of those things that is really tough to replicate without using animal products.

And we are so used to cheese on everything. Cream cheese on bagels, parmesan on pasta, nacho cheese dip with our chips, sliced cheese on all the sandwiches, and so much more. Cheese is everywhere.

Store-bought dairy-free/vegan cheese can be a total hit or miss. I’ve tried so, so many types from every different brand I could find. And about 75% of them are either absolute misses or just underwhelming.

However, I have found some totally delicious vegan cheese at the store!

Store-Bought Cheese Recommendations:

  • GoVeggie Cream Cheese
  • Kite Hill Mozzarella
  • VioLife Shredded Mozzarella
  • VioLife Shredded Cheddar
  • Follow Your Heart Sliced Gouda
  • Follow Your Heart Sliced American
  • Follow Your Heart Shredded Parmesan
  • Miyoko’s Garlic Herb Cheese Wheel
  • Field Roast Chao Slices

But don’t stop there! While store-bought vegan cheese has come a long way, I also recommend making your own at home. They are often easy to make, healthier, and totally customizable to your flavorful preferences!

Is vegan cheese actually healthier? ›

Vegan cheeses are typically lower in fat, protein and calcium than regular cheese and are likely gluten-free. Because vegan cheese is a processed food, it tends to be higher in sodium, so check your labels.

Why are cashews used in vegan cheese? ›

Nuts were a game-changer for vegan cheese because they provide a lot of fat: 100 grams of cashews have 44 grams of fat, versus 6.4 grams of fat in the same amount of soybeans. This allows for richer flavor and texture that gets closer to imitating animal milk dairy.

Is too much vegan cheese bad for you? ›

Plant-based cheese is almost 10% saltier than regular cheddar and equally high in saturated fat, despite its perceived “health halo”, Action on Salt has warned. The organisation found that plant-based cheeses have the highest salt levels, containing an average of 1.91g per 100g.
